Sleep

Vue. js functionality directives: v-once - Vue.js Supplied

.Providing performance is actually a necessary statistics for frontend creators. For each second your webpage takes to provide, the bounce cost rises.And when it relates to creating a soft individual adventure? Near fast responses is crucial to offering people a receptive application take in.While Vue is actually currently one of the better executing JavaScript platforms away from package, there are ways that designers can boost the performance of their applications.There are a number of means to enhance the rendering of Vue applications - varying coming from online scrolling to maximizing your v-for elements.However one extremely simple means to maximize making is actually through just re-rendering what you need to.Whenever a part's data changes, that part and its kids will re-render, there are actually ways to deal with unnecessary tasks with a lesser-used Vue regulation: v-once.Let's hop right in and also observe how our team can use this in our application.v-once.The v-once directive leaves the element/component when as well as just once. After the first provide, this aspect and all of its own children will be actually managed as stationary material.This could be great for improving render functionality in your application.To use this, all we need to perform is actually add v-once to the component in our layout. Our company don't also need to have to incorporate an articulation like a few of Vue's other ordinances.msgIt deals with solitary factors, elements along with kids, components, v-for directives, everything in your theme.// ~ app.vue.
msgnotice
itemTherefore let's mention we possess this instance design template along with some sensitive information, a paragraph along with v-once, and also a button that changes the content.// ~ vonceexample.vue.
msgImprovement notification.Current state:.msg: msg
When our team click our button, our company can easily see that despite the fact that the value of msg modifications, the paragraph performs certainly not modify with the help of v-once.When used along with v-if or v-show, as soon as our element is rendered once, the v-if or even v-show will no more administer meaning that if it shows up on the first render, it will certainly constantly show up. As well as if it's hidden, it is going to regularly be actually hidden.
msgButton.Change message.Present condition:.msg: msg
When would certainly I use v-once?You need to make use of v-once if there is no scenario that you will need to have to re-render a factor. A married couple examples could be:.Presenting account relevant information in the sidebar.Showing post content.Lingering the pillar names in a table.Clearly, there are actually lots of various other instances - however just think of if this works effectively in your application.

Articles You Can Be Interested In